Richard’s Sanitation owner Richard Skauge dies April 23 PDF Print
richardskauge.jpgLongtime Caledonia-area businessman Richard S. Skauge 61, died Thursday, April 23 at his Spring Grove home.
Skauge owned and operated Richard’s Sanitation, which served the communities of Caledonia, Spring Grove, Brownsville, Eitzen, Houston, Mabel, Canton, French Island, Wis., as well as a number of businesses in the La Crosse area.
Skauge started the sanitation business in the mid-1970s with Marcus Schwebach and Gilbert Hauser under the name Caledonia Sanitation Service. Skauge became the sole owner of the business in the 1980s, changed the name to Richard’s Sanitation and has been serving customers in Houston, Fillmore and La Crosse counties ever since.
In the 1990s Richard’s Sanitation began offering roll-off collection containers to better accommodate his customers.
According to family members, future plans are to continue the business operations as they are currently conducted.
